本文目录导读:
数据仓库的存储方式概述
数据仓库作为企业信息化的核心,是实现数据分析和决策支持的重要工具,数据仓库的存储方式直接影响着数据仓库的性能、可扩展性和数据安全,本文将详细解析数据仓库的存储方式,并探讨其在实际应用中的优势。
数据仓库的主要存储方式
1、关系型数据库存储
关系型数据库存储是数据仓库最传统的存储方式,其核心思想是将数据存储在关系型数据库中,通过SQL语句进行数据查询和分析,关系型数据库存储具有以下特点:
(1)数据结构清晰,易于维护和扩展;
图片来源于网络,如有侵权联系删除
(2)支持复杂的查询和关联分析;
(3)具有较高的数据安全性。
关系型数据库存储也存在一些局限性,如数据存储效率较低、查询性能受限于数据库规模等。
2、文件存储
文件存储是将数据以文件形式存储在文件系统中,通过文件路径进行数据访问,文件存储具有以下特点:
(1)存储成本较低,适用于大量数据的存储;
(2)易于数据备份和恢复;
(3)支持多种文件格式,如文本、XML、JSON等。
文件存储也存在一些问题,如数据管理难度大、查询性能较差等。
3、分布式文件系统存储
分布式文件系统存储是将数据分散存储在多个服务器上,通过分布式文件系统进行数据访问,分布式文件存储具有以下特点:
(1)可扩展性强,能够适应大规模数据存储需求;
(2)具有良好的数据容错能力;
图片来源于网络,如有侵权联系删除
(3)支持数据负载均衡。
分布式文件存储在实际应用中存在一定的挑战,如数据一致性保证、数据访问性能等。
4、NoSQL数据库存储
NoSQL数据库存储是一种非关系型数据库存储方式,适用于处理大量非结构化或半结构化数据,NoSQL数据库存储具有以下特点:
(1)可扩展性强,能够适应大规模数据存储需求;
(2)数据结构灵活,支持多种数据类型;
(3)具有良好的数据读写性能。
NoSQL数据库存储在实际应用中存在一定的局限性,如数据安全性、事务处理等。
5、混合存储
混合存储是将多种存储方式相结合,根据数据特点和应用需求选择合适的存储方式,混合存储具有以下特点:
(1)提高数据存储效率,降低存储成本;
(2)增强数据安全性,提高数据可靠性;
(3)满足不同应用场景的需求。
图片来源于网络,如有侵权联系删除
混合存储在实际应用中具有广泛的应用前景,但同时也增加了数据管理难度。
数据仓库存储方式的选择与应用
数据仓库存储方式的选择应综合考虑以下因素:
1、数据规模和增长速度;
2、数据类型和结构;
3、应用场景和需求;
4、技术水平和预算。
在实际应用中,可根据以下原则选择合适的存储方式:
1、对于结构化数据,可采用关系型数据库存储;
2、对于非结构化数据,可采用文件存储或NoSQL数据库存储;
3、对于大规模数据存储,可采用分布式文件系统存储;
4、对于混合数据存储,可采用混合存储方式。
数据仓库的存储方式多样化,应根据实际需求选择合适的存储方式,以提高数据仓库的性能、可扩展性和数据安全性。
标签: #数据仓库的存储方式
评论列表